22/07/2020 – FACT - FAshion Community Talk

Topic: Color Design & Development Monitoring

Digital color design has long been one of the exciting opportunities of digitalization for the fashion industry. Now, in times of the corona crisis, every digital solution and implementation of manual tasks also means the possibility of maintaining processes and adapting to current conditions. Bob Chin, Director Business & Process Management Innovation of Under Armour USA, and Christoph Bergmann, Co-Founder of Natific, talk more about this topic in episode 9 of FACT and show the added value of digital Color Design & Development Monitoring for them.
